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08 654 210740052
91928384517 8917 68236952595
91928384517 8917 68236952595
653584289 47175777 26
All about undefined
Interested in learning more?
91928384517 8917 68236952595
653584289 47175777 26
See more
81 39
30 337288869 54372446357
See more
27690436361 881
96719314 6556 306
See more